MARKETING AND COMMUNICATION ASSOCIATE 

The Marketing and Communications Associate will develop and implement a broad and comprehensive marketing, communications, and brand management strategy designed to enhance Saint Dominic Academy’s visibility, reputation, and position as a leader in girls’ education. The strategy will promote enrollment, re-enrollment, fundraising, and brand awareness, as well as internal and external communications among all constituencies. The Associate promotes a culture and environment in which the school’s commitment to diversity, equity, inclusion, belonging, and anti-racism are kept central to the school’s messaging, climate, and culture in support of our mission. This position reports directly to the Director of Advancement & Enrollment Management.

Duties:

  • Responsible for developing and implementing the long-term marketing & communication vision for Saint Dominic Academy’s brand, which promotes its unique position in the marketplace.
  • Establish and maintain a communication/marketing calendar to ensure consistent content production and meeting established deadlines.
  • Develop content for publications, including design, photography,  and storytelling about the school across multimedia platforms.
  • Responsible for creating and implementing a website content plan. Update all copy that is posted on the website and coordinate with all departments to keep website content accurate.  Assure the layout and aesthetic elements are on brand while creating content that is relevant to our target audience and demographics.
  • Develop new social media strategies and campaigns.
  • Schedule social media outreach using multiple applications. Posting new content frequently to optimize search hits, increase SEO, and increase social followers.
  • Keep track of data and analyze the performance of social media campaigns.
  • Monitor all affiliated social media accounts maintained by SDA groups and sports.
  • Maintain a strong presence at school, attending school sponsored events throughout the year.
  • Assist, as needed, in emergency and crisis communications in collaboration with the Administration.
  • Other marketing and communication duties as may be assigned by the Director of Advancement and/or Head of School.

Required q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Marketing and/or Communications or related field.
  • 1-3 years experience in a marketing/communications role, preferable in a school environment but not required.
  • Results-oriented leader with the ability to use appropriate metrics to make decisions, guide the school’s marketing & communications strategy and lead to achievement in articulated goals that energize the school community.
  • Experience in graphic design, brand management, and writing.
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and in-person. You deliver your ideas clearly and confidently.
  • Experience producing digital content across channels and platforms.
  • Proficient in various web-based tools including Google suite, Microsoft suite, Adobe Acrobat.
  • Experience with WordPress, Constant Contact and Canva a plus.
  • Ability and willingness to learn new software as required.

 

This is a 12-month, full-time position.  Workdays are Monday through Friday; some nights and weekends will be required for fundraising and school events.

Compensation:

Salary is commensurate with experience. Benefits include medical, dental and vision insurance as well as a 401K, vacation, sick, and personal time off.
